WebMar 19, 2024 · 1 Answer. Sorted by: 1. You need to understand how scoping works with foreach. Any variables set inside the foreach scope will NOT be available outside of that scope. However, variables set outside of the foreach scope (e.g. a set-variable before the foreach) will be available inside the foreach scope.
